Jorge for Model Number PYGT344AWW I moved to a house that does not have gas, just electricity, I cannot use my dryer, can it be changed to be electric instead? If that is not possible can I change it then from natural gas to lp gas by using a small lp gas tank? If this is possible, please let me know which parts should be switched.
Answer Jorge, No, you can't convert a gas dryer into an electric dryer, it would not be cost effective. You can convert the dryer gas valve to LP Gas and use a gas supply tank, but you will also need to install a gas regulator on the tank to maintain the 10 to 11 WCI pressure to the dryer gas system.
